Mini Replacement Key Fob

Modern key fobs provide more convenience than traditional mechanical backup keys. They let owners lock and unlock their vehicle and then start it by pressing a button.

Mel Yu, Automotive analyst at Consumer Reports, says that these devices could wear out and require mini replacement key fob. Dealerships charge $50 to $100 for replacement fobs, and to program them to your vehicle.

How to replace a fob

Most cars have key fobs that can open doors and begin engines. These devices are convenient however they can be costly to fix when they fail. The battery can fix a lot of key fob issues. This simple step will save you from the need to visit a car repair shop or dealership.

If changing the batteries does not work, you can try reprogramming your remote. Fobs get jostled around a often, and buttons may be misaligned, Mini Replacement Key preventing the device from working properly. A professional may be able to assist you get the fob trained to recognize new signals.

Certain car models require special code to unlock the vehicle and then start the motor. These codes are only given to licensed locksmiths and dealers that have the necessary equipment to program the fobs. The cost for programming the keys is around $200, and that includes an additional mechanical backup key.

Consumer Reports reports that you can save money by buying a replacement key fob on the internet or at an auto parts shop in your neighborhood. These fobs have to be programmed for your car. This can be done by the dealer or by a licensed locksmith However, you'll need proof of ownership to speed up the process. You can also find out whether your warranty or insurance covers the cost of replacing a fob.

Fobs with a remote

Modern electronic key fobs provide convenience and function over manual keys. However the technology isn't completely foolproof and can fail in different ways. If your vehicle's sensor Mini Replacement Key begins to fail it is usually the cause. You can replace the battery yourself for less than $10 at an hardware store or big-box retailer, and many automakers will provide instructions on how to do it yourself in the owner's manual. If the fob has stopped functioning completely, it might be time to replace it.

Some people can save money on a replacement key fob by buying aftermarket keys online or from an auto-parts shop, and then having them programmed by an expert locksmith or mechanic. According to CR, a professional might cost anywhere from $100 to $200 for programming the fob to your vehicle.
